Subject: Partner SFTP cut-over — done

Hey all, quick recap for the sync: we finished moving the Brindlewood partner drop off the old Ferrous box last night. Files now land on the new Quaymark host, same folder layout, and the poller picked up the morning batch without a hiccup. Retries are tighter now (3 attempts, 20s backoff), so watch for alert noise early in the week. For reference, the poller is currently running with these settings.

service settings:
PRAIX_LOG_LEVEL=error
PRAIX_METRICS_HOST=metrics.praix.qorvelcorp.corp
PRAIX_POOL_SIZE=16

To: Dispatch Desk. Subject: Calibration weights — outbound batch. The batch of twelve certified calibration weights for the Stornhale metrology lab is packed and sealed in the grey transit case. Each weight sits in its numbered cradle; the certificates are in the document sleeve inside the lid. Please note the case must remain upright and must not be opened before it reaches the lab, or the certification is void. Collection is booked for tomorrow morning. The hand-over instruction for the courier is as follows:

drop instructions, yahip-fahag: the novix praeth courier leaves the jorox ledger at gate 1058 under passcode 030252

14:22 — Tilegrove cache layer began serving stale map tiles after an eviction-policy deploy. No unauthorized access occurred; the fault was a TTL misread, not a bypass. Rollback completed at 14:41 and cache keys were fully repopulated by 15:05. The offending deploy is identified by the trace token below.

session token of fahap-hawip = htk31_7852f2b3276dba2738f98fa97f92237

## Environments

GrowLoop's staging environment mirrors production except for sensor calibration. Because the Harvale test greenhouse uses older humidity probes, drift compensation is tuned more aggressively there; do not copy staging values into production, as over-correction will cause the vents to cycle. Each environment carries its own drift thresholds and recalibration intervals. The production environment uses the following configuration.

deployment values, yahag-tawef:
ZORWYN_HOST=zorwyn.tolvaqlabs.internal
ZORWYN_PORT=9300